你查询的IP:[124.220.138.71]  地理位置:中国–上海–上海

最新查询221.14.188.136 125.216.120.34 203.90.245.164 202.122.107.83 124.196.202.10 220.234.226.215 117.80.182.228 117.124.19.236 59.192.153.219 124.220.138.71 119.27.64.140 118.132.1.23 202.38.140.194 202.136.208.91 60.253.128.147 116.255.128.241 202.75.208.209 203.81.16.137 202.131.208.187 203.191.64.174 116.66.187.106 202.130.53.169 116.242.245.166 123.253.193.44 117.21.56.103 218.185.192.91 210.25.218.69 119.78.86.117 119.57.6.60 203.90.192.175 203.158.16.35